Property description & features
The land lies in a single contiguous block with direct vehicular access from the Ashford Road. It is understood that the land has been in permanent pasture for many years, and has been used for hay or grazing use in recent times. The land is classified as Grade 2 under the former DEFRA agricultural land classification system, and field boundaries are fenced principally with older post and wire stock-proof fencing.
The Buildings
At the northern boundary of the land is a substantially built traditional agricultural barn, of brick and ragstone elevations under a green box-corrugated roof. The northern elevation of the building comprises three brick arches, later infilled with two windows and a central timber sliding door. This barn measures approximately 775 sq ft (71 sq m). At the southern end of the land is a small block-built field shelter measuring approximately 220 sq ft (20 sq m).

Overage: A new overage clause will be imposed at date of sale. The Buyer will be required to enter into an overage agreement with the Seller for a period of 25 years from the date of the purchase. If the Buyer, or any subsequent owner, obtains and implements a planning permission for residential or commercial development, including any permitted development (or sells the property with the benefit of that planning permission) the Buyer will be required to pay the Seller 25% of any uplift in value of the property. Situation
The land is situated on Ashford Road, in a rural position on the outskirts of New Romney, the town known as ‘The Capital of Romney Marsh.’ This small market town has a bustling high street of independent shops, cafés and public houses, as well as larger facilities including supermarket, schools, library and doctors surgery. The A259 provides good access south west to Rye and north east to Hythe, whilst The M20 and Ashford International Station lies approximately 16 miles to the north.
